Output d66103a53710d85914466e10bb0ced56cdb84b87a62884646357b5f953a03cc9:14

value
59340500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ab8124954810366f4178a6beb8c144baeeaaef OP_EQUAL
address
MAEtaZj56XDLWmnzLXLHc4sH5fqxbcG2VL
transaction
d66103a53710d85914466e10bb0ced56cdb84b87a62884646357b5f953a03cc9
spent
true